Summer School on Digital Technologies Hosted by Strathmore University

DIGITAfrica is pleased to share that Strathmore University, in collaboration with DIGITAfrica partners and leading European universities, will host a Summer School on Digital Technologies aimed at strengthening advanced skills in Networking, Cloud Computing, and Artificial Intelligence.

The programme will take place from 23 to 27 March 2026 at Strathmore University in Nairobi, Kenya, and will bring together undergraduate and master’s students, recent graduates, early-career practitioners, and professionals from Kenya and other African countries.

Participants will engage in an intensive week of hands-on learning, expert-led sessions, and networking opportunities with peers, researchers, and practitioners across the continent. The summer school is designed to combine the academic rigour of leading European summer schools with the context of the African digital and innovation ecosystem, ensuring both high-quality technical training and regional relevance.

Upon completion, all participants will receive a recognised certification, validating their newly acquired skills and supporting career development in emerging digital technologies.
